4 hours ago, Bigdickjohnson said:

So, im planning on buying a second hand iphone 8 thats locked with icloud(no clue what that means). Is there a way to unlock it? I read about a few ways to unlock it but they look fake. What do you guys think, is there a way to unlock it 100%?

Just don't.

 

The only way to remove the activation lock is to have the original owner sign into their Apple ID Account and then manually sign out of all services on the phone.

 

So if you're buying locally, you could get the previous owner to do the sign-in/sign-out process when you pick it up (BEFORE YOU HAND THEM ANY MONEY). If they can't or won't unlock it? Run. Run for the hills.

On 9/27/2018 at 1:53 PM, Bigdickjohnson said:

is there a way you can wipe everything, install a new rom or whatever the ios equivalent is called?

You can reinstall iOS but the device just asks for the original iCloud account upon setup. iCloud lock is pretty darn tight.
